Gualeguaychu Carnival


When:  Every year, during January and February.

Where:  Gualeguaychu, Argentina



This spectacular carnival is the third most important carnival worldwide, next to those of Rio of Janeiro, takes place every year from the beginning of February (summer in Argentina). During all month long, bands of streets musicians and artists (murgas) play in various neighborhoods of Buenos Aires.

Country background and overview:

Following independence from Spain in 1816, Argentina experienced periods of internal political conflict between conservatives and liberals and between civilian and military factions. After World War II, a long period of Peronist authoritarian rule and interference in subsequent governments was followed by a military junta that took power in 1976. Democracy returned in 1983, and has persisted despite numerous challenges, the most formidable of which was a severe economic crisis in 2001-02 that led to violent public protests and the resignation of several interim presidents.

[Courtesy of The World Factbook]
